Отправка сообщений на сетевые ПК в домене
Доброго дня, есть небольшая база в которую вносятся данные вручную, нужно после внесения данных отправить сообщение на несколько ПК. Попробовал реализовать через PsExec, создав скрипт который запускаю фоном:
PHP код:
psexec64 pc1,pc2,pc3,pc4,pc5 msg * ДОКУМЕНТЫ ОБНОВЛЕНЫ
Все работает только при работе от пользователя с правами доменного администратора, что естественно не допустимо.
Попытался реализовать добавив имя пользователя и пароль
PHP код:
psexec64 -u moydomenuser1 -p pass2211 -e pc1,pc2,pc3,pc4,pc5 msg * ДОКУМЕНТЫ ОБНОВЛЕНЫ
И ничего не работает.
|
DJ Mogarych |
07-12-2021 14:56 2974586 |
А если комп выключен или недоступен по сети, то его пользователь никогда не узнает эту прекрасную новость.
Отправляйте в почту через Powershell (Send-MailMessage), или, если вы поклонник архаики, через консольный клиент типа blat.
|
Цитата:
Цитата DJ Mogarych
А если комп выключен или недоступен по сети, то его пользователь никогда не узнает эту прекрасную новость. »
|
Они и не должны узнать, эта информация актуальна только для тех кто на рабочем месте находится, что бы не терять время и начинать работать с новыми данными.
|
Так же почему то не идут от имени пользователя, только от имени доменного администратора
|
DJ Mogarych |
07-12-2021 16:35 2974598 |
Ну создайте пользователя и дайте ему права на пользовательские тачки.
|
fimus, скорей всего не от доменного администратора, а от доменного пользователя с правами локального администратора. В скрипты здесь особо не нужно, нужно в настройку.
1. Создайте пользователя
2. Через GPO дайте ему права локального администратора на компьютерах домена
3. Запретите ему логиниться (как локально так и по RDP, емнип это отдельные пункты)
4. Создайте задание от этого пользователя в шедулере с возможностью ручного запуска (или с триггером на завершение обновления этих ваших документов)
|
Всем спасибо, реализовал все по средствам планировщика, через который пользователь и запускает скрипт от имени пользователя с правами администратора.
|
Время: 16:45.
© OSzone.net 2001-